CAROL LADY HAYNES was yesterday sworn in as Barbados’ newest senator to fill the vacant position left by Tony Marshall, who has been appointed Barbados’ representative to the United Nations.

Governor General Sir Elliott Belgrave administered the oath at Government House while Lady Haynes’ sons Richard and Kashka and their wives looked on. Less than an hour later, Lady Haynes was off to the Senate to participate in her first debate.

Here, a confident-looking Lady Haynes (centre) leaving Government House after the brief ceremony. From left are Michelle Haynes, her husband Richard, Kashka Haynes and his wife Meredith.
